R&D européenne : Tulipp accouche d’une panoplie d’outils pour le design de systèmes de vision

Le 12/07/2019 à 12:10 par Didier Girault
Tulipp

La plateforme de référence Tulipp est un kit de développement complet avec carte de calcul, système d’exploitation temps réel, outils de développement et exemples d’utilisation.

Le projet Tulipp (Towards Ubiquitous Low-power Image Processing Platforms), qui a vu le jour en 2016 et s’est achevé cette année, et qui a été financé à hauteur de presque 4 millions d’euros dans le cadre du programme européen Horizon 2020, a abouti à la mise à disposition des concepteurs de systèmes de vision, d’une plateforme de référence. Celle-ci inclut une carte de calcul, un système d’exploitation temps réel, des outils de développement ainsi que des exemples d’utilisation (imagerie médicale aux rayons X, assistance à la conduite et vols de drones autonomes) couvrant pratiquement tous les cas de figure auxquels peuvent être confrontés les équipements de vision.

D’une manière générale, les systèmes de vision utilisent de plus en plus de capteurs – eux-mêmes de plus en plus performants -, un sous-ensemble de traitement des données images et un sous-ensemble dédié à la visualisation. Défi supplémentaire, il leur faut consommer le moins possible.

Tulipp s’était donc donné pour mission la mise au point d’une plateforme de haut niveau et à faible consommation, destinée à faciliter la mise au point de systèmes de vision industriels. Cette plateforme devait aussi être modulaire de façon à répondre à des demandes de complexités diverses. C’est-à-dire qu’elle devait être dotée de divers processeurs de traitement des données et de traitement graphiques (GPU) connectables et synchronisables, et pouvant être déconnectés, le cas échéant. C’est Sundance Multiprocessor Technology qui s’est chargé du développement de cette plateforme.

Hipperos s’est chargé de réaliser le système d’exploitation temps réel souhaité. Quant aux outils de développement, ils ont été conçus pour s’articuler avec les outils de développement des divers composants clés inclus dans la plateforme matérielle. Exemple : les outils Vivado pour les FPGA Xilinx. Enfin, un ensemble de conseils et de meilleures pratiques est fourni à l’utilisateur- concepteur.

« Le projet européen Tulipp a bien rempli ses objectifs. En outre, l’écosystème d’acteurs du domaine que nous avons créé tout au long du projet assurera sa continuité dans le futur. Tulipp laissera vraiment un héritage », a déclaré Philippe Millet (Thales), le coordinateur du projet Tulipp.
 

Copy link
Powered by Social Snap